JetBlue was still feeling blue yesterday as it tried to reset from a terrible Tuesday. 6% cancelled is still way bad, though. United was also poor at 3% cancelled which is a lot more flights cancelled than JetBlue because they are many times larger. Today doesn’t look great for New York and Boston, but we will see how that develops.
2026/07/29 23:56 Cancelled/Delayed for Large U.S. Airlines
--- (Compared to 2019/07/31 00:00)
JetBlue (B6) 6% (9) CXLD, 38% (47) DELYD
United (UA) 3% (4) CXLD, 29% (30) DELYD
Frontier (F9) 3% (5) CXLD, 34% (37) DELYD
American Airlines (AA) 2% (4) CXLD, 28% (25) DELYD
Delta Air Lines (DL) 1% (1) CXLD, 17% (19) DELYD
Alaska Airlines (AS) 1% (1) CXLD, 17% (16) DELYD
SkyWest (OO) 0% (2) CXLD, 23% (13) DELYD
Southwest (WN) 0% (2) CXLD, 28% (20) DELYD
Hawaiian Airlines (HA) 0% (0) CXLD, 30% (11) DELYD
